Output 8510fef984f21a793710ed104cb8f5ab804fd338486e6fd87ef28de352472754:1

value
191066874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97037a55a5d55aa629dd18108c690a41ace60414 OP_EQUAL
address
3FTW8A3Z6vPtbe5y6WWj6hBo4cd76PhPCr
transaction
8510fef984f21a793710ed104cb8f5ab804fd338486e6fd87ef28de352472754
spent
true